From the Lebrecht Album of the Week:

Pierre Boulez/Alfred Schnittke: Piano works (Naxos/BIS)

***/**

It’s a mark of how far Naxos have come under new ownership that a label which once churned out the complete waltzes of Johann Strauss now gives us piano works by the ultra-serious Pierre Boulez. Also under changed management, the Swedish label BIS continues its three-decade exploration of the Russian outcast, Alfred Schnittke. The results are… mixed….
